The Story

About This Place

Ciao Bella sits on Võ Trường Toản in An Phú, a quieter residential stretch in the broader Thao Dien corridor. With 293 Google reviews averaging 4.4 stars, it has built the kind of following that takes sustained consistency to accumulate — not a venue riding an opening wave, but one that has been feeding the neighborhood long enough for repeat visitors to outweigh first-timers in the review pool.

Thao Dien has no shortage of Italian options. The dense expat population in nearby apartment towers — Thao Dien Pearl, Masteri, The Estella — sustains consistent demand for European cuisine, and several Italian kitchens compete for the same Tuesday-night pasta craving. A 4.4-star average in that field is a genuine signal, placing Ciao Bella credibly in the upper range of the neighborhood's Italian scene without requiring a special-occasion reason to visit.

The hours — 11 AM to 10 PM, identical every day including weekends — make the math simple for residents who want a reliable lunch option or a last-minute dinner table that doesn't require a reservation call. That kind of operational consistency tends to attract a local crowd rather than destination diners: expat families cycling through a reliable rotation, couples who live within ten minutes, colleagues settling a team lunch.

For visitors coming from central Saigon, the An Phú location is most sensibly paired with other errands or stops in the Thao Dien area rather than treated as a standalone destination. For those already in the neighborhood, it offers a straightforward Italian meal without the unpredictability of a newer or more experimental option.

Where is Ciao Bella located in Thao Dien?
Ciao Bella is located at 39 Võ Trường Toản, An Khánh, Hồ Chí Minh 00002, Vietnam. It is situated in the Thao Dien neighborhood of District 2 (Thu Duc City),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am.
